Informational Citizenship (InfoCitizen)

Toward a global ethnography of practices and infrastructures of datafication in the Global South

We combine ethnography, history, and digital humanities to explore how grassroots organizations engage with data to negotiate their sociocultural and political-economic citizenship from the margins.

We connect top-down and bottom-up practitioners, stakeholders, experts, and citizens across data ecosystems in Brazil (Rio de Janeiro and São Paulo), Portugal, Germany, Kenya and Tanzania to reimagine subjectivity, community, law- and policy-making in the era of digital development.
